Consumer Protection in respect of Digital Marketing Activities

The regulator requires authorized institutions to ensure all digital marketing materials are fair, accurate, and compliant with consumer protection principles while avoiding misleading representations. Institutions must implement effective internal review mechanisms and conduct prudent due diligence when engaging third parties or influencers to safeguard consumer interests. Furthermore, institutions are obligated to maintain editorial control over third-party content and ensure customers have access to adequate information to make informed decisions before entering into contracts.
